Combination treatment of lycopene and hesperidin protect experimentally induced ulcer in laboratory rats.

作者信息

Jain Dilpesh, Katti Neha

机构信息

Department of Pharmacology, Sinhgad College of Pharmacy, Vadgaon, Pune, Maharashtra, India.

出版信息

J Intercult Ethnopharmacol. 2015 Apr-Jun;4(2):143-6. doi: 10.5455/jice.20150314061404. Epub 2015 Mar 16.

DOI:10.5455/jice.20150314061404
PMID:26401402
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C4566771/
Abstract

AIM

Lycopene, a carotenoid and hesperidin, a flavonoid are naturally occurring in vegetables and fruits. Synergistic effect of a combination of carotenoid and flavonoid has been reported due to its antioxidant activity. Therefore, the present study was aimed to evaluate the protective effect of this combination on pylorus ligation induced ulcers in rats.

MATERIALS AND METHODS

Thirty Wistar albino rats were divided into five groups (n = 6). Rats were fasted for 24 h before pylorus ligation. After 24 h of fasting the rats were treated with hesperidin (100 mg/kg) and lycopene (2 mg/kg) and their combination 1h prior to surgery. After an hour under ether anesthesia pylorus ligation was performed, after 5 h the animals were sacrificed, stomach was dissected, and gastric contents were collected and measured. Total acidity and pH of gastric content was estimated. Ulcer index was calculated, and macroscopic examination of the stomach was carried out.

RESULTS

The sham operated rats showed a significant increase in pH, volume of gastric content and total acidity and ulcer index. The rats pretreated with lycopene and hesperidin showed significant improvement in the ulcer conditions. However, rats treated with a combination of lycopene and hesperidin showed more significant restoration of gastric function as compared to sham operated rats. Moreover, a significant difference was also noted in rats treated with a combination as compared to lycopene and hesperidin treatment alone.

CONCLUSION

Thus experimentally the combination was seen to treat ulcers by anti-secretory, neutralizing, cytoprotective and mainly due to its antioxidant property.

摘要

目的

番茄红素(一种类胡萝卜素)和橙皮苷(一种黄酮类化合物)天然存在于蔬菜和水果中。据报道,类胡萝卜素和黄酮类化合物组合具有协同效应,因其具有抗氧化活性。因此,本研究旨在评估该组合对幽门结扎诱导的大鼠溃疡的保护作用。

材料与方法

将30只Wistar白化大鼠分为五组(n = 6)。在幽门结扎前,大鼠禁食24小时。禁食24小时后,在手术前1小时,给大鼠分别注射橙皮苷(100毫克/千克)、番茄红素(2毫克/千克)及其组合。在乙醚麻醉下1小时后进行幽门结扎,5小时后处死动物,解剖胃,收集并测量胃内容物。估计胃内容物的总酸度和pH值。计算溃疡指数,并对胃进行宏观检查。

结果

假手术组大鼠的pH值、胃内容物体积、总酸度和溃疡指数显著增加。预先用番茄红素和橙皮苷处理的大鼠溃疡状况有显著改善。然而,与假手术组大鼠相比,用番茄红素和橙皮苷组合处理的大鼠胃功能恢复更为显著。此外,与单独使用番茄红素和橙皮苷处理的大鼠相比,联合处理的大鼠也有显著差异。

结论

因此,通过实验观察到该组合通过抗分泌、中和、细胞保护作用,主要因其抗氧化特性来治疗溃疡。
